Bulgarian Red Cross / www.redcross.bg 15 It is the impartiality and neutrality of the organization that allow it to assist the vulnerable people in difficult situations, to be autonomous and be accessible to all. In order to fulfil its mission, BRC needs the support and the response of the whole society.
